Speed Sensor Questions
Hey there, I just replaced the clutch in my 2015 Accord EX 6-speed. It drives and shifts smoothly so everything is usable, but a few things are not working properly after I put everything back together.
First, my speedometer is not working. During the process of taking out my hubs I took out the speed sensors that stick into the hub. I made sure to put them back in and I didn’t stress the wires that were connected to the sensor at any time. It seems simple enough but is there something I needed to do to properly reinsert them or should I just buy new sensors...?
Second, when I was driving prior to the clutch change, if I drove fast enough, my shifter wouldn’t allow me to move into reverse. Now, I can be on the freeway going 65 and I can put it in position to pull it into reverse which freaks me out because it would be really easy to accidentally shift into reverse instead of 6th. Did I loosen something I need to tighten when I changed my clutch or can someone tell me if this is a product of the speed sensor not working as well?
Any information is appreciated
